A COMPARATIVE STUDY BETWEEN CARDIAC - RADIONUCLIDE STUDIES AND ECHOCARDIOGRAPHY IN THE EVALUATION OF CARDIAC FUNCTIONS IN PEDIATRIC,PATIENTS WITH MYOCARDIAL DISEASE
HEBA DOSOKY EID ABD ALLAH;
Abstract
The status of the myocardium is a critical factor in the prognosis of cardiac disease.
The cardiomyopathy IS a disease of heart muscle that demonstrates a defect in the function of the myocardium precluding the heart from maintaining adequate systemic perfusion with normal filling pressure.
Acute rheumatic fever has a worldwide distribution and continues to be a major cause of heart disease in developing countries. Repeated attacks of rheumatic carditis affect the myocardium and in the long run lead to cardiac fibrosis and myocardial damage.
The present study was carried out on 22 patients (I 3 females and
9 males) with congestive heart failure (12 patients with rheumatic heart disease and 10 patient with cardiomyopathic heart disease). They either attended the Pediatric Cardiology Clinic or were admitted in the Pediatric Hospital, Ain Shams University.
